Anticipating Earnings Insights from Mayville Engineering

The Upcoming Earnings Report of Mayville Engineering
Mayville Engineering (NYSE: MEC) is set to unveil its quarterly earnings report soon. Investors are eagerly looking forward to this announcement as it could significantly impact the stock's performance. With anticipation building, it's essential to understand what to expect and how to interpret the results.
Analyst Expectations for Earnings
Analysts predict that Mayville Engineering will report an earnings per share (EPS) of $0.05. This figure serves as a critical benchmark for both existing and potential investors. The actual performance relative to this estimate will be closely watched, as it may lead to shifts in investor sentiment.
Market Reactions: Important Considerations
While the earnings report itself is crucial, market reactions are often driven by the guidance provided by the company for future quarters. Thus, investors should be particularly attentive to any forecasts or strategic changes that management discusses during the earnings call.
Historical Earnings Performance of Mayville Engineering
In analyzing past performance, Mayville Engineering's stock has shown variability in its response to earnings announcements. In the preceding quarter, the company reported an EPS that beat expectations by $0.02, but this led to a 2.36% drop in share price the following day. Such trends highlight the complexity of stock reactions to earnings news.
Review of Previous Earnings Results
Looking at Mayville Engineering's earnings history provides essential context. The following illustrates how the company’s EPS performance and resultant stock price changes have unfolded:
Recent Performance Summary:
- Q1 2025: EPS Estimate: $0.02, Actual: $0.04, Price Change: -2.0%
- Q4 2024: EPS Estimate: -$0.08, Actual: -$0.07, Price Change: -0.0%
- Q3 2024: EPS Estimate: $0.21, Actual: $0.21, Price Change: -20.0%
- Q2 2024: EPS Estimate: $0.19, Actual: $0.26, Price Change: 11.0%
Current Stock Performance and Market Sentiment
As of August 1, shares of Mayville Engineering were trading at approximately $16.4. During the past year, the stock has experienced a decline of about 0.78%.
